It's important to do your own research and evaluate the credibility of a journal before submitting your work. One way to do this is to check if the journal is indexed in reputable databases such as PubMed, Web of Science, or Scopus. Indexing in these databases is generally considered a sign of a reputable journal.
You can also check if the journal is a member of a professional association, such as the International Society of Managing and Technical Editors (ISMTE) or the Committee on Publication Ethics (COPE). These organizations have Codes of Conduct and guidelines that member journals are expected to follow.
You can also check the journal's website, look for information about the editorial board and the review process, read the "about us" page and look for the journal's mission statement, and check if the journal is open access or not.
It's also important to be aware of predatory journals, which are journals that falsely claim to be legitimate and may ask for money to publish your article without providing any real peer-review or editorial process.
In the end, the best way to ensure that your article is being published in a reputable journal is to consult with your colleagues or supervisor, or reach out to a librarian for help.
